sudo

joined 1 year ago
[–] sudo@programming.dev 0 points 2 months ago (3 children)

I'm pretty sure all the major distros have FDE as an option in the installer its just never on by default. Fedora does the same but with BTRFS on LUKS. I'm sure Debian does. Someone else says OpenSuse does. Maybe some derivative distros don't but I suspect the ones with an graphical installer do.

[–] sudo@programming.dev 3 points 2 months ago

Looks like they use eCryptFS. Never heard of it before so thats neat. I can see using it on systems where you can't reinstall the system with Dm-crypt but it most cases I suspect Dm-crypt is a better alternative.

Idk if its faster or slower than Dm-crypt.

[–] sudo@programming.dev 40 points 2 months ago (14 children)

The standard route is to decrypt on boot. It happens after GRUB but before your display manager starts. IDK if there even is a setup that has you "decrypt on login". Thats sounds like your display manager (sddm for KDE) is decrypting system which is not possible IMO.

Unless your laptop somehow has multiple drives you'll want to use the "LVM on LUKS" configuration. 1 small partition for /boot. The rest gets LUKS encrypted, and an LVM group is put on the LUKS container. Or you could replace LVM with btrfs.

This will require wiping your system and reinstalling so you have some reading to do.

The arch-install script in the live iso has options for full disk encryption.

If you suspend to RAM your system will stay unencrypted, because your ram is not encrypted. if you suspend to disk (aka hibernate) your system will be encrypted. You go through the boot loader when waking from hibernation but it just drops you off where you left off.

You need a swapfile for hibernation so make sure its inside the LUKS container.

[–] sudo@programming.dev 1 points 4 months ago (1 children)

We would easily be able to tell if an Alexa was constantly streaming audio data by monitoring its network traffic. It'd be just a wasteful inefficient implementation to stream everything 24/7. Makes much more sense to only start recording when it hears certain keywords that it can recognize locally beyond "Alexa".

[–] sudo@programming.dev 1 points 4 months ago (1 children)

It can only recognize certain hotwords on its own, eg, Alexa. So its not recording 24/7 but it is listening 24/7 for hotwords. They could push additional words and start recording whenever they hear it.

[–] sudo@programming.dev 51 points 5 months ago (1 children)

We let almost all manufacturing jobs go overseas just to cut labor costs and now we're suffering the consequences and our government completely incapable of doing what's necessary to bring that manufacturing capability back to the US. At this point basic Keynesians economic policy is tantamount to heresy for anyone but the far left. Its like we've adopted the economic policies we forced on third world nations, and found ourselves with a third world economy.

Being able to produce cheap drones as good as DJIs is far more important for national security than whatever espionage risk they pose. Cheap, easy to use, drones like the dji phantom are omnipresent in current wars. Banning them prevents us from learning via competition or basic reverse engineering.

[–] sudo@programming.dev 12 points 5 months ago

This loony bullshit is why tankies go full useful idiot and parrot shit most of them know isn't true. The right-wing disinfo about Tianamen square - or any other communist atrocity - is so widespread. Tankies think that the most ultra counter-narrative will somehow combat that even if its just as loony.

[–] sudo@programming.dev 1 points 6 months ago (2 children)

Mercurial or darcs?

[–] sudo@programming.dev 39 points 6 months ago* (last edited 6 months ago) (16 children)

git is a way more important contribution to the world that the linux kernel IMO. Its basically the assembly line of almost all modern software production. And Linus actually wrote most of the initial code for it. With Linux he organized the project but was almost immediately not a major contributor. He developed git in the process of maintaining the linux repo.

[–] sudo@programming.dev 4 points 6 months ago (2 children)

You were supposed to use plastic coffee straws not a hard piece of metal. Turn a $1 bag of 100 straws into $25-$100 in laundry change depending on how much your reuse the straws.

view more: ‹ prev next ›